bilaminar

[bahy-lam-uh-ner]

bilaminar Definition

having two layers or laminae.

Summary: bilaminar in Brief

The term 'bilaminar' [bahy-lam-uh-ner] is an adjective that describes something having two layers or laminae. It is commonly used in embryology to describe the bilaminar structure of the embryo during gastrulation.
